French Door Fridge Vs Side by Side Refrigerators

When looking for a brand new refrigerator, you need to assess your family's particular storage needs. French door refrigerators have double doors that open up to a large refrigerator space with an under-counter freezer compartment.

Side-by side refrigerators have fridge and freezer compartments next to one another. This can be useful in small spaces where a large swinging door might restrict access. They also have useful features like ice and water dispensers, adjustable shelves and crisper drawers with humidity controls.

Space

Melding form with function, French door refrigerators boast double doors that open up to a spacious, comfortable interior. With a wide-width fridge on top and a freezer down below, there's plenty of room for fresh food, drinks and much more. A french door refrigerator is a great option for kitchens with small french door fridge spaces since it offers a uniform space distribution. Its narrow double doors require less clearance and swing, making them a good option for small spaces.

The French door configuration provides numerous storage options, such as adjustable shelves, pantry drawers and door bins that allow you to easily customize your refrigerator to fit your needs. A French door refrigerator can have more capacity than a side-by-side model, which means you can store more food.

A side-by-side refrigerator has its advantages, too. With their freezer at eye level fisher and paykel french door fridge ice maker well-organized shelves, side-by-side refrigerators are simple to navigate. They also usually have more space for freezers than the French door model.
